Last week was agriculture practicum.  We visited the local 4H in Linstead where we learned how to graph and bud plants.  We also had a tour of their small farm.  The next day we went to Walkerswood, where there is a farmers association and it’s where they make the famous jerk seasoning.  We toured the farm and watched the other group build a green house (we helped a little).  That same day we went to another farm, which was primarily a lettuce farm where they had both green house and open farming.  Some of the green house farming was hydroponic, so that was interesting to see.  The manager of the farm invited us to his house to see some of his wife’s art work, she is a famous sculpture artist and sculpted the statue in emancipation park in Kingston (pretty big deal).  They then took us down to the white river to cool down and go for a swim.  What a beautiful river, a fantastic experience.

Friday we went to Ochi to hear a lecture on sea turtle monitoring on the north coast and invasive aquatic species in Jamaica (including Lion Fish).   These fish are native to the south pacific and were introduced into the Caribbean in the 90’s.  This fish is very aesthetically pleasing to divers and swimmers but has no natural predators here so is depleting the native fish population.  It has poisonous venom in its spines.  We learned to properly remove the spines, de-scale, and clean them.  After that we went to a fish fry where we ate Lion Fish provided by the local fisherman’s coop.   After that we went to a local swim spot on the White River near Ochi where we enjoyed a couple hours of swimming.  A group of us went back on Saturday to enjoy the swimming hole even more.  There were swimming holes, waterfalls, and rope swings.
